ICD-10-CMSpondylopathy in diseases classified elsewhere, cervicothoracic region
This code signifies a disorder of the vertebrae and associated structures in the neck and upper back regions, occurring as a manifestation or complication of another underlying systemic disease. It indicates a secondary spondylopathy, where the primary pathology is classified elsewhere in the ICD-10-CM system.
Apply this code when documentation specifies a cervicothoracic spondylopathy directly attributed to a systemic condition, such as rheumatoid arthritis, psoriatic arthritis, or other inflammatory arthropathies. The medical record must clearly link the spinal involvement to the primary disease process.
